It's almost marathon time again! Finally!
Mar. 21st, 2008 05:02 pmExactly one week from now I will be in Star Wars fangirl bliss! Here are the rules I'm abiding by. They're written as if someone else would be watching with me.
I only tweaked these slightly. The boldinated stuff is my commentary, which changes from marathon to marathon.
1) Don't watch ANY of the movies for at least one month prior to the marathon, if not longer.
Got that covered. It's been about two.
2) The first movie (The Phantom Menace) starts at 7:00am, possibly can be delayed 'til 7:30 but NO LATER THAN THAT. Just because.
I don't think I've actually ever started as late as 7. I don't know what I'm gonna do when we have the new Clone Wars stuff out on dvd. O.o Not enough hours in the day!
3) Bathroom breaks between movies only. Yes, I realize there's a pause button, or that you might be willing to miss a few minutes to go relieve yourself, but still. Shouldn't have to do that.
4) Snacking/eating during the movies is fine, but no stopping in between movies to go get food. Just easy, microwave stuff.
Yes, you can see the TV from my kitchen, so this is quite do-able.
5) No phone calls/texts. Cell phones turned off, ringer turned off on house phone. No returning messages between movies either. No one is going to die if you don't talk to them.
I should probably revise this rule because I'm possibly tempting fate here? But I do have a very drama-free life, free of family emergencies and the like. *knock on wood*
6) Petting cats is okay. They get whiny sometimes if they want attention and you ignore them. But you should try to get the cat to watch the movie with you rather than play.
At least twice now, Anakin has left the room during RotS. LOL
7) Moving around during the movies is okay. I can't sit still for so many hours myself!
And actually, last time I remember I dozed through a bit of Empire. FOR SHAME. Must move around more.
8) No talking during the emo parts, including the pre-emo or buildup-to-emo parts. Only crying is allowed.
9) No interwebz. Full attention paid to the movies.
